Leading Performers and Their Archetypes
Each leading performer on the Avengers cast list embodies a distinct archetype that shapes team dynamics. Robert Downey Jr. infuses Tony Stark with wit and vulnerability, anchoring the group in human complexity. Chris Evans portrays steadfast idealism, providing a counterbalance to Stark’s mercurial brilliance.
Mark Ruffalo brings thoughtful introspection as Banner, merging scientific rigor with primal power. Chris Hemsworth grounds the ensemble with physicality and humor, while Thor’s arc explores humility and responsibility. Together, these performances create a cohesive core that drives the narrative forward.
Supporting Cast and Their Contributions
Beyond the central lineup, the supporting cast expands the universe’s texture. Scarlett Johansson and Jeremy Renner deliver grounded, mission-focused performances that highlight teamwork and trust. Tom Hiddleston adds layers of charm and menace as Loki, elevating conflict without overshadowing the heroes.
Samuel L. Jackson’s Nick Fury serves as the connective tissue, orchestrating cross-character interactions with authority and foresight. These roles ensure that the Avengers cast list functions as an interconnected network rather than a loose gathering.

Which actor appears earliest in the Marvel Cinematic Universe timeline among the core Avengers cast?
Robert Downey Jr. as Tony Stark debuted in Iron Man (2008), making him the earliest core Avenger introduction within the shared timeline.
